quota: drop remount argument to ->quota_on and ->quota_off
[safe/jmp/linux-2.6] / block / noop-iosched.c
index 7563d8a..232c4b3 100644 (file)
@@ -5,6 +5,7 @@
 #include <linux/elevator.h>
 #include <linux/bio.h>
 #include <linux/module.h>
+#include <linux/slab.h>
 #include <linux/init.h>
 
 struct noop_data {
@@ -76,7 +77,7 @@ static void *noop_init_queue(struct request_queue *q)
        return nd;
 }
 
-static void noop_exit_queue(elevator_t *e)
+static void noop_exit_queue(struct elevator_queue *e)
 {
        struct noop_data *nd = e->elevator_data;
 
@@ -101,7 +102,9 @@ static struct elevator_type elevator_noop = {
 
 static int __init noop_init(void)
 {
-       return elv_register(&elevator_noop);
+       elv_register(&elevator_noop);
+
+       return 0;
 }
 
 static void __exit noop_exit(void)